1. Understanding Real Estate as a Retirement Asset: Building a Strong Foundation

a) Diversification Benefits: Real estate offers diversification from traditional investment vehicles like stocks and bonds. It can act as a hedge against market volatility and provide stable income.

b) Appreciation Potential: Historically, real estate has appreciated in value over time. This potential for capital appreciation can contribute to your retirement nest egg.

2. Identifying Your Investment Goals: Defining Your Retirement Vision

a) Short-Term Income: If you’re nearing retirement, focus on properties that generate immediate rental income to supplement your retirement funds.

b) Long-Term Growth: If you have time on your side, consider properties that have the potential for long-term appreciation, maximizing your returns upon retirement.

3. Rental Properties: Generating Passive Income Streams

a) Single-Family Homes: Owning single-family rental properties can provide consistent rental income and the advantage of a manageable investment.

b) Multi-Unit Properties: Investing in multi-unit properties, such as duplexes or apartment buildings, can offer higher rental income while diversifying risk.

c) Property Management: Consider whether you’ll manage the properties yourself or enlist the services of a property management company to handle day-to-day operations.

4.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s): Low-Barrier, High-Diversification Option

a) What are REITs: REITs are investment vehicles that pool funds from multiple investors to invest in a diversified portfolio of real estate properties.

b) Benefits of REITs: REITs offer liquidity, diversification, and the opportunity to invest in various real estate sectors without the direct ownership responsibilities.

5. Location and Market Research: Maximizing Returns

a) Market Selection: Choose markets with strong economic fundamentals, population growth, and job opportunities to ensure demand for rental properties.

b) Property Appreciation: Research historical property appreciation rates in your chosen market to gauge its long-term potential.

6. Financing and Cash Flow: Balancing the Numbers

a) Financing Options: Evaluate different financing options, such as traditional mortgages or leveraging retirement accounts for real estate investments.

b) Cash Flow Analysis: Calculate expected rental income and deduct operating expenses to determine your potential cash flow. Positive cash flow is crucial for a sustainable investment.

7. Tax Considerations: Minimizing Tax Implications

a) Depreciation Benefits: Real estate investors can take advantage of depreciation deductions, reducing their taxable rental income.

b) 1031 Exchange: Explore the option of a 1031 exchange to defer capital gains taxes when selling a property and reinvesting the proceeds into another property.

8. Exit Strategy: Preparing for Retirement

a) Selling vs. Holding: Decide whether you’ll sell properties upon retirement for a lump-sum payout or continue to hold them for ongoing rental income.

b) Estate Planning: Consider how real estate investments fit into your estate plan to ensure a smooth transition of assets to your heirs.

9. Professional Advice: Guided Decision-Making

a) Financial Advisor: Consult a financial advisor to align your real estate investment strategy with your overall retirement goals.

b) Real Estate Professionals: Enlist the expertise of real estate agents, property managers, and legal advisors who specialize in retirement-focused investments.
